You know why I asked? About this Zuiko lenses ahead along with the focal there's written AUTO-S and I was wondering that it was

avatarsenior
sent on August 24, 2018 (10:04) | This comment has been automatically translated (show/hide original)

It probably meant that the vision and focus was at full aperture, and then for the shot the diaphragm was automatically closed to the diaphragm chosen. Even the light measurement was carried out correctly despite the diaphragm remaining completely open. At that time not all did.
